Hallo Allemaal,
Ik heb een scriptje waarin een transition staat. die wordt aangeroepen door de volgende regel:
<body onload="dotransition()">
Nu is het probleem dat deze niet werkt in firefox. heeft iemand een ander scriptje om deze transition te laten uitvoeren?
Groet Basbgm
Voor een voorbeeld kijk op http://www.basb.nl.eu.org/niek in de top (onder ie uiteraard)
hieronder het script waar het dan om gaat:
<body onload="dotransition()">
<script>
messages = new Array()
messages[0] = "Dit is werkelijk een geweldig mooi teksteffect"
messages[1] = "Handig om je bezoekers ergens op te wijzen"
messages[2] = "Met eenvoudige variabelen zoals kleur, positie en tekstgrootte."
messages[3] = "Wederom een scriptje van mij"
messages[4] = "Maak van je site een Suc6...!."
<!-- verander hierboven de teksten -->
mescolor = new Array()
mescolor[0] = "000000"
mescolor[1] = "FF0000"
mescolor[2] = "0000CC"
mescolor[3] = "9900FF"
mescolor[4] = "CCFF00"
<!-- verander hierboven de kleuren -->
messize = new Array()
messize[0] = "20pt"
messize[1] = "30pt"
messize[2] = "20pt"
messize[3] = "25pt"
messize[4] = "30pt"
<!-- verander hierboven de tekstgrootte -->
var i_messages = 0
var timer
function dotransition() {
if (document.all) {
content.filters[0].apply()
content.innerHTML = "<span style='color:"+mescolor[i_messages]+";font-size:"+messize[i_messages]+";filter: revealTrans(Transition=12, Duration=3)'>"+messages[i_messages]+"</span>"
content.filters[0].play()
if (i_messages >= messages.length-1) {
i_messages = 0
}
else {
i_messages++
}
}
if (document.layers) {
document.content.document.write("<span style='color:"+mescolor[i_messages]+"'>"+messages[i_messages]+"</span>")
if (i_messages >= messages.length-1) {
i_messages = 0
}
else {
i_messages++
}
}
timer = setTimeout("dotransition()",5000)
}
</script>
<DIV id=content style="position: absolute; top:20; left:20; width:520; height:200; text-align:center; filter: revealTrans(Transition=12, Duration=2)"></DIV>
Ik heb een scriptje waarin een transition staat. die wordt aangeroepen door de volgende regel:
<body onload="dotransition()">
Nu is het probleem dat deze niet werkt in firefox. heeft iemand een ander scriptje om deze transition te laten uitvoeren?
Groet Basbgm
Voor een voorbeeld kijk op http://www.basb.nl.eu.org/niek in de top (onder ie uiteraard)
hieronder het script waar het dan om gaat:
<body onload="dotransition()">
<script>
messages = new Array()
messages[0] = "Dit is werkelijk een geweldig mooi teksteffect"
messages[1] = "Handig om je bezoekers ergens op te wijzen"
messages[2] = "Met eenvoudige variabelen zoals kleur, positie en tekstgrootte."
messages[3] = "Wederom een scriptje van mij"
messages[4] = "Maak van je site een Suc6...!."
<!-- verander hierboven de teksten -->
mescolor = new Array()
mescolor[0] = "000000"
mescolor[1] = "FF0000"
mescolor[2] = "0000CC"
mescolor[3] = "9900FF"
mescolor[4] = "CCFF00"
<!-- verander hierboven de kleuren -->
messize = new Array()
messize[0] = "20pt"
messize[1] = "30pt"
messize[2] = "20pt"
messize[3] = "25pt"
messize[4] = "30pt"
<!-- verander hierboven de tekstgrootte -->
var i_messages = 0
var timer
function dotransition() {
if (document.all) {
content.filters[0].apply()
content.innerHTML = "<span style='color:"+mescolor[i_messages]+";font-size:"+messize[i_messages]+";filter: revealTrans(Transition=12, Duration=3)'>"+messages[i_messages]+"</span>"
content.filters[0].play()
if (i_messages >= messages.length-1) {
i_messages = 0
}
else {
i_messages++
}
}
if (document.layers) {
document.content.document.write("<span style='color:"+mescolor[i_messages]+"'>"+messages[i_messages]+"</span>")
if (i_messages >= messages.length-1) {
i_messages = 0
}
else {
i_messages++
}
}
timer = setTimeout("dotransition()",5000)
}
</script>
<DIV id=content style="position: absolute; top:20; left:20; width:520; height:200; text-align:center; filter: revealTrans(Transition=12, Duration=2)"></DIV>

Laatst bewerkt: